Just bought a new Audiovox VX6600 Pocket PC running Windows 2003 and Active
Sync Version 3.7.1. Everything seems to work fine with one exception. When
using Active Sync, everything is synchronized (Calendar, Tasks, Favorites and
Inbox), but my Contacts catagory tells me "Sync status is on the device".
None of my contacts in Outlook on my home computer make it over to my Pocket
PC.
When setting up the partnerships, the Contacts catagory shows up only being
available when syncing to a server. I'm attempting to get my contacts out of
Outlook 2002 on my XP Home PC. Is there a reason that it will not accept my
contacts?

Chris, Thanks for your reply.... I was just fiddling with Active Sync this
morning, changing any setting I could find to see if it made any difference.
As it turns out, on the Options/Sync Options menu for Active Sync, if you
uncheck the "Enable synchronization with a server" option, it then moves the
contacts category up into the Desktop area where it syncs just fine. I've
been pulling my hair out for 3 days trying to get my contacts to sync and all
it was was a simple checkbox under settings...
